Half way there with half wickets gone and two sessions to play....Tough ask, and a shame Duckett now gone. He has put in the hard yards that Pope, Crawley and somewhat Brook failed to do.
Another poor showing from Root - he really needs to play his traditional game and sit in there. Wicket slowly improved from a batting perspective and Stokes can obviously hit the high figures too.
Going to take something special from Bairstow, Broad and Robinson...not expecting much from Anderson or Tongue obviously.
I do think with a traditional Test approach in the first session, England would have made things easier for themselves in trying to win. Aussie's will probably slowly pick England off or the game will run out of time. A draw probably suits both right now but Aussies probably also seeing blood now. That would still leave everything to play for. Third Test clearly will be key for England and must win.
NB: On Australia...they actually are a very beatable side, which is frustrating. They're probably a slightly above average test side - the trouble with England is part of their own creating, they aren't playing anything like a traditional test side, not even individually. It's telling when the req R/R is currently around about or under 4 per over, proving that a fully aggressive approach isn't needed. They've got to mix it up a bit - let the ''one dayers'' play Bazball, then Root and maybe one other {not sure who - maybe Stokes}.
